Load the image, copy-paste and resize it to match the template. Open with paint.net the template and start skinning. (Skip this step if you want to make a different trailer instead (see 2))2. Search for an image you want to use for the trailer. Updated 4 days ago by Jazzycat.- Paint.net, or any other professional image editor like Photoshop.- This trailer template, or this if you want to go in the less confusing way1. Overweight Trailers and Cargo Pack by Jazzycat 9.9.1.
Open ETS2 Studio, choose "Trailer Generator", and choose the trailer type you want to use (only use the SCS types). The file type does matter because only DDS or PNG files will be supported.4. Once you finished skinning (like this: ), it's time to save your file as xy.dds or xy.png (the xy doesn't matter). Be sure to also edit the outlines, or you'll get the same color at few parts of the trailer.3.
Give the trailer some cargo's, at least one, or the trailer will not appear on the city's companies. You can also check the "Enable Trailer in AI Traffic" if you want to make more variety to the game. I recommend to give the internal name just 5 letters. IMPORTANT: Give the trailer an internal name, or else your mod will not work correctly. Choose it, and go to Trailer Properties. Go to Trailer Skin, and find the DDS/PNG file you just made.
Open ETS2, edit your profile, and check the trailer skin. Move that file to the game's mod folder in Documents.8. It will appear as a scs file. When you're done, click on Export mod, and name the trailer skin.
